Dubai Chamber's Centre for Responsible Business (CRB) is to hold a workshop on the social responsibility of supply chains, supporting the notion that supply chains have been thrust into the limelight in recent years.
The workshop will last one and a half days, from August 31 to September 1, and is entitled The Environmental and Social Impacts of Supply Chains.
Recently, a rising demand from consumers for both ethical goods as well as environmentally friendly goods has led to a company's supply chain management becoming one of the most influential aspects of the product.
